完美解決 Cannot read property 'length' of undefined

easyUI 前端

easyui中datagrid執行loadData方法出現以下異常java

此時這裏的rows==undefined,因此報錯了,能夠在for循環前判斷rows是否大於0 ,但更好的辦法是在後臺解決,讓返回的json數據裏面包含rows屬性,設置其默認值爲0就好json

解決辦法:ui

這個問題迷惑了我兩三個小時,想一想均可怕。雖然是底層js報錯,可是隻要知道緣由,跟着具體緣由改改就行了。其實也沒那麼難,畢竟我是搞java的,今天老大讓我改前端,哎,心疼本身三秒鐘......blog

相關文章
相關標籤/搜索